What is the Arrearage Worksheet for Spousal or Child Support?
The Arrearage Worksheet for Spousal or Child Support is a crucial legal document used in Louisiana family courts. This worksheet is designed to assist in tracking and documenting unpaid support payments effectively. It plays a significant role in maintaining records of monthly award amounts, payment dates, and accumulated arrears.
In the context of this form, the main participants are the petitioner and defendant. Properly completing this worksheet ensures that all parties are aware of their obligations and entitlements regarding support payments.

Who is eligible to use the Arrearage Worksheet?
Any individual in Louisiana who is either receiving or making child or spousal support payments can use the Arrearage Worksheet. It helps in tracking unpaid support effectively.
What is the deadline for submitting this form?
There is no specific deadline for using the Arrearage Worksheet. However, it is advisable to complete and submit the form promptly after payments are missed to ensure accurate tracking.
How should I submit the completed form?
Once completed, you can submit the Arrearage Worksheet to your local family court. It may be advisable to confirm any specific submission requirements with your court.
Are supporting documents needed with this form?
While not explicitly required, it is helpful to attach proof of payments made and any communication regarding missed payments for accurate record-keeping.
What common mistakes should I avoid?
Ensure all fields are accurately filled out, particularly dates and amounts. Missing or incorrect entries can result in delays in processing your claims.
How long does processing take once submitted?
Processing times can vary based on the court's workload. It's advisable to follow up with the court after submission for updates.
